Does St Marten take American money? Or do we need to change to another currency?
 
we never had problems using it at all.
 
Dutch Sint Maarten: the official currency is the Netherlands Antillean Floren, but all merchants with whom you will be dealing will have prices marked in U.S. dollars and will accept your U.S. dollars and give you change in U.S. currency.

French Saint Martin: the official currency is the French Franc, but all merchants with whom you will be dealing will have prices marked in U.S. dollars and will accept your U.S. dollars and give you change in U.S. currency.

Ironically, although U.S. dollars are accepted on both sides of St Maarten, the French currency is not accepted on the Dutch side, and the Dutch currency is not accepted on the French side.
 
Just a note..The Franc has been replaced by the Euro.
Your US$ are accepted everywhere, like Dave stated.
